What is the electronic signature legality for legal services in Australia
The electronic signature legality for legal services in Australia is governed by the Electronic Transactions Act 1999 and the Australian Consumer Law. These laws establish that electronic signatures are legally binding, provided they meet specific criteria. This means that legal documents can be signed electronically, ensuring they are valid and enforceable in court. Understanding this legality is essential for legal professionals and businesses to streamline their operations and enhance efficiency.

Security & Compliance Guidelines
Ensuring security and compliance when using electronic signatures is crucial. Users should adhere to the following guidelines:
- Use a reputable eSignature platform that complies with local laws and regulations.
- Implement strong authentication methods, such as two-factor authentication, to verify signers' identities.
- Maintain an audit trail that records all actions taken on the document, including timestamps and IP addresses.
- Ensure data is encrypted both in transit and at rest to protect sensitive information.
Examples of using the electronic signature legality for legal services in Australia
There are various applications for electronic signatures in legal services, including:
- Signing contracts and agreements, such as leases and service contracts.
- Finalizing legal documents like wills or powers of attorney.
- Obtaining client consent forms electronically for faster processing.
- Facilitating remote signings for clients who cannot be present in person.

What is the electronic signature legality for legal services in Australia?
In Australia, the electronic signature legality for legal services is governed by the Electronic Transactions Act 1999. This legislation recognizes electronic signatures as valid, provided the signatory intends to sign the document. It is essential that the eSignature process adheres to the specific requirements set out in the laws to ensure enforceability.
